You desire to observe details of the Statue of Freedom, the sculpture by Thomas Crawford that is the crowning feature of the dome of the United States Capitol in Washington D.C. For this purpose you construct a refracting telescope, using as its objective a lens with focal length 87.7 cm. In order to acheive an angular magnification of magnitude 5.31, what focal length should the eyepiece have?
